100% Sangiovese
In the same family since the 1950s, Antonio Moretti Cuseri released the first wines under their own Sette Ponti label (Seven Bridges, named for the bridges over the famous Arno river between Florence and Arezzo) in 1998. The family has made Sette Ponti into a modern powerhouse, with best-selling wines such as Crognolo and Oreno. The very limited Vigna dell'Impero bottling is named for the oldest vineyard on the property, consisting of organically farmed Sangiovese planted in 1935, making this arguably their most "traditional" wine.
WINE SPECTATOR 95 POINTS - "This is all about purity, finesse and energy. A line of cherry and raspberry flavors runs through this red, with grace notes of leather, tobacco, graphite and underbrush. Reined-in and firm, yet balanced, with a lingering aftertaste of cherry, mineral, and spice. Best from 2021 through 2045."
